Transaction 2df3148f030e7e2ceb6621c6772818d0443cac9f72ab4ac24b993fbd5f890f7d
1 Input
1 Output
-
2df3148f030e7e2ceb6621c6772818d0443cac9f72ab4ac24b993fbd5f890f7d:0
- value
- 58400977432
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70f7e35bb377dd2d56e7fb2b719ce2b4a0607a61 OP_EQUALVERIFY OP_CHECKSIG
- address
- DFSRBK3GHB9XsEUVsCXrqypUTEbEmiF67d